WebTo discuss the idea of peace we shall start from three simple principles: 1. The term 'peace' shall be used for social goals at least verbally agreed to by many, if not necessarily by most. 2. These social goals may be complex and diffi-cult, but not impossible, to attain. 3. The statement peace is absence of violence shall be retained as valid.
